Get in Touch** The Kia repair market in the Kane, Illinois area is characterized by a clear tiered structure. The single most critical player is the official Kia dealership (**Gerald Kia**), which holds a monopoly on certain warranty authorizations and proprietary software updates, especially for advanced safety features (Drive Wise) and EVs. This makes them the unavoidable, and often best, choice for specific, warranty-covered issues. The independent market is competitive and quality-focused, serving customers seeking value, personalized service, or repairs outside of warranty. Shops like **Car-Fix Auto Repair** and **Precision Tune Auto Care** compete directly by employing Kia-experienced technicians and investing in the necessary tools for GDI, turbo, and DCT services. They have built strong local reputations through high customer satisfaction scores. **Typical Pricing:** Dealership labor rates are premium (often $160-$190/hr), reflecting factory training and overhead. Top-tier independents are typically 15-25% less expensive ($130-$160/hr), making them an attractive option for out-of-warranty vehicles. The market supports this price differentiation, as customers recognize the value of specialized expertise for Kia's complex drivetrains.

Common repairs include suspension components due to local potholes and rough rural roads, as well as brake system wear from frequent stop-and-go traffic on routes like Randall Road. Engine-related issues, particularly with Theta II engines in certain older models, are also a known concern that reputable local shops are familiar with diagnosing.
Look for shops that are Kia-certified or have technicians with specific Kia training, which several local independents offer. Check reviews mentioning Kia models and ask if they use genuine Kia parts or high-quality equivalents, as shops near the I-90 corridor often service many Kias and understand their specific needs.
Seek immediate diagnosis, especially before longer drives on I-90 or during extreme temperature swings common to Northern Illinois, which can exacerbate underlying issues. Prompt service can prevent minor problems from becoming major, costly repairs, particularly with emissions or engine management systems.
Typically, independent repair shops in Kane County offer more competitive labor rates than the nearest Kia dealerships, while providing equivalent quality for most repairs. However, for complex computer or warranty-related work, a dealership's specialized proprietary tools and software may sometimes be necessary.
The harsh Midwest winters require diligent attention to battery health, tire condition, and undercarriage corrosion from road salt. Additionally, frequent short trips in towns like Geneva or St. Charles necessitate more regular oil changes and fluid checks to prevent sludge buildup compared to ideal driving conditions.
